The last 2 days have been filled with bookwork, filing and “house” cleaning.  I love that cleaning my home takes under an hour.  However, the amount of laundry a family of 4 produces is amazing to me.  I miss my washer and dryer at my “real” home.  I spent $18 at the laundry mat today!  We had a small leak under our bathroom sink so I had an extra load of smelly towels to wash.  I tried the idea of adding borax to this load and it took out the smell and made the whites very white.  I’m officially sold on adding borax to my laundry now.
